Made for Each Other: The Biology of the Human-Animal Bond BISAC-YAF071000 based on the Wurtzburg ManuscriptNothing turns a baby's head more quickly than the sight or sound of an animal. This fascination is driven by the ancient chemical forces that first drew humans and animals together. It is also the same biology that transformed wolves into dogs and skittish horses into valiant comrades that would carry us into battle. Made for Each Other is the first book to explain how this chemistry of attraction and attachment flows through and between all mammals
